Abstract:

On Jan. 7-8, 2025, several wildfires occurred across multiple counties around the Los Angeles area, exacerbated by high winds, and prompting Gov. Gavin Newsom to declare a state of emergency. The Palisades, Eaton, and Hurst fires have collectively burned over 5,500 acres according to the California Department of Forestry and Fire Protection (CalFire). In particular, the Palisades fire has resulted in nearly 3,000 acres burned, two fatalities, and over 1,000 structures damaged or destroyed. More than 10,000 structures remain threatened by the fire, and thousands have been evacuated because of the wildfire?s severity. The wildfires in and around the service territory of Edison International?s subsidiary, Southern California Edison (SCE), reflect SCE?s highly challenging operating environment because of climate change.
